I enjoy pulling up my frequency responses in rew, going to the EQ tab and trying to manually eq the results with as few of bands as possible. You can also do this pre-crossover or too wide of crossover and try to really get your crossovers frequency, type (LR or butterworth, or one of the other options), and slope (6, 12, 24, 36) perfect. Note, you will have to stack two 12/db crossovers to get 24db crossovers if that is required. When REW does it automatically via the match response, it does a decent job. But I find I usually can do the same with less bands of EQ.

Remember, the crossover type and the slope does not matter for the dsp settings other than protecting the speakers (don't cross too low). All that matters is does the speaker response match acoustically a 24db/oct acoustical curve.
